Blender is a powerful 3D computer graphics software that includes a wide range of features, including the ability to simulate various types of fluids and liquids. With Blender's fluid simulation capabilities, you can create realistic animations of liquids such as water, milk, or any other fluid you desire.

To create a liquid simulation in Blender, you'll need to follow these general steps:

1. **Setting up the scene**: Start by opening Blender and setting up the scene for your liquid simulation. This includes creating the objects you want to interact with the liquid and adjusting the camera and lighting as needed.

2. **Creating the liquid domain**: In Blender, you need to define a region called the "domain" within which the liquid simulation will take place. This acts as a container for the fluid. To create the domain, select an object that will act as the container and go to the "Physics Properties" panel. Enable the "Fluid" simulation type and set it to "Domain."

3. **Adding an obstacle or object**: To interact with the liquid, you'll need to add an object or obstacle that the fluid can collide with. Create a new object or select an existing one and enable the "Fluid" simulation type for it. Set the type to "Obstacle" to define its behavior when interacting with the fluid.

4. **Configuring the fluid settings**: Once you have your domain and obstacle, it's time to adjust the fluid settings to achieve the desired behavior. Parameters such as viscosity, surface tension, and particle resolution can be adjusted to control the fluid's appearance and dynamics. Experimenting with these settings will help you achieve the desired liquid effect.

5. **Baking the simulation**: After configuring the fluid settings, you need to "bake" the simulation, which calculates and stores the animation data for the fluid. To do this, go to the "Physics Properties" panel for the domain object and click on the "Bake" button. This process may take some time, depending on the complexity of your scene and the settings you've chosen.

6. **Previewing and rendering the simulation**: Once the simulation is baked, you can preview it in the viewport to see how the fluid behaves. You can scrub through the timeline or play the animation to observe the liquid simulation in action. If you're satisfied with the result, you can render the animation to create a final video file or image sequence.

It's important to note that fluid simulations can be computationally intensive, especially for complex scenes or high-resolution simulations. You may need a powerful computer to handle the calculations efficiently. Additionally, the specific steps and options may vary slightly depending on the version of Blender you are using, so it's always a good idea to refer to the official Blender documentation or tutorials for more detailed instructions tailored to your version.
